The Yamaha RX100 is not just a motorcycle—it is an emotion for generations of Indian riders. Launched in the 1980s, the RX100 earned legendary status due to its lightweight build, sharp acceleration, and unmistakable exhaust note.

Even years after production ended, the RX100 continues to command respect and nostalgia among bike enthusiasts, collectors, and everyday riders alike. Its cult following has never faded, making it one of the most talked-about motorcycles in India’s history.

RX100 Legacy: Why It Still Matters
The original RX100 became famous for its raw riding experience. It was quick, agile, and simple to maintain. Riders loved its instant throttle response and minimal weight, which made it fun and practical at the same time. Even today, well-maintained RX100 units are highly valued in the used-bike market.
This emotional connection is exactly why Yamaha’s decision to revive the RX100 name carries such significance. It represents trust, excitement, and a timeless riding experience.
